You can see the > planned versions and dates here: > https://bugs.tizen.org/jira/browse/TIVI#selectedTab=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.project%3Aversions-panel > **** > > ** ** > > Unlike the Mobile profile, IVI does not support the “OSP” native APIs. So > “Native” app development is done with the underlying platform component > APIs. For example you can use EFL or OpenGL, and also use gstreamer, or > bluez, or connman APIs etc. The “Lemolo” dialer is an example of a native > application. > https://review.tizen.org/git/?p=profile/ivi/lemolo.git;a=summary. You > may get answers from the general tizen mail list that talk about doing > native development using OSP native APIs that won’t apply to doing IVI > development. **** > > ** ** > > Developers typically use GBS and MIC for development, and there is much > discussion here on how to use it.
